Section courante

A propos

Section administrative du site

CreateDesktopA

user32.dll Crée un bureau
Windows NT 3.1+, 2000, XP, 2003

Syntaxe

HDESK CreateDesktopA(LPCTSTR lpszDesktop, LPCTSTR lpszDevice, LPDEVMODE pDevMode, DWORD dwFlags, DWORD dwDesiredAccess, LPSECURITY_ATTRIBUTES lpsa);

Paramètres

Nom Description
lpszDesktop Ce paramètre permet d'indiquer le nom du bureau à créer.
lpszDevice Ce paramètre doit toujours a être NULL.
pDevmode Ce paramètre doit toujours a être NULL.
dwFlags Ce paramètre permet d'indiquer les options de cette fonction :
Constante Valeur Description
DF_ALLOWOTHERACCOUNTHOOK 0x0001 Cette constante permet d'activer le processus exécutant les autres comptes dans le bureau vers la procédure crochet de ce processus.
dwDesiredAccess Ce paramètre permet d'indiquer l'accès vers le bureau.
lpsa Ce paramètre permet d'indiquer un pointeur vers une structure SECURITY_ATTRIBUTES déterminant que doit retourner le gestionnaire quand il hérite d'un processus enfant.

Description

Cette fonction permet de créer un nouveau bureau dans une fenêtre de station associé avec le processus appelant.

Voir également

Articles - Les géants de l'informatique - Microsoft

Dernière mise à jour : Dimanche, le 6 décembre 2015